- 博客(99)
- 收藏
- 关注
原创 关于MCP,这几个网站你一定要知道!
昨晚熬夜解决项目问题时,突然想起了最近很火的 MCP,就尝试用 Cursor + MCP 修复项目 Bug,折腾了几个回合,也算是顺利的把 Bug 搞定了,爽!前几天刷 X 时看到奥特曼也宣布 ChatGPT 将支持 MCP 协议,这节奏看来 MCP 真有可能成为下一个 AI 的标配啊,作为大语言模型的对接的通用协议!在解决问题的过程中,我也发现了一些很有意思的 MCP Server 网站,分享给大家。
2025-04-08 10:07:02
226
原创 关于Node.js,一定要学这个10+万Star项目 !!
说实话,之前我总觉得编码就是实现功能,能跑就行。接触 Node.js Best Practices 后,我才明白写出高质量的 Node.js 代码需要考虑这么多方面。最后,强烈推荐每一个使用 Node.js 的开发者都去看看这个项目。它不仅告诉你“怎么做”,更重要的是解释了“为什么要这么做”,这对于提升开发能力至关重要。
2025-04-02 10:53:43
237
原创 做定时任务,一定要用这个神库!!
作为前端开发者,我们的工作不只是构建漂亮的界面,还需要处理各种复杂的交互和时序逻辑。npm 的 cron 包为我们提供了一种专业而灵活的方式来处理定时任务,特别是在 Node.js 环境下运行的前端应用(如 SSR 框架、Electron 应用等)。它让我们能够用简洁的表达式设定复杂的执行计划,帮助我们构建更加智能和用户友好的前端应用。
2025-03-28 12:48:18
251
原创 从开发者到讲师,我第一次教跨行业AI写代码的心路历程
不要怕第一次:每个"老师"都有第一次,重要的是开始以学员为中心:时刻关注学员的接受程度,适时调整节奏多准备实例:实际的案例比空洞的理论更容易理解保持互动:频繁的互动可以及时发现问题,也能调节课堂氛围善用类比:用生活中的例子来解释技术概念,效果往往很好这次经历让我明白,教学不仅是在帮助别人,更是在提升自己。
2025-03-25 12:46:28
148
原创 为什么 AI 总在 “靠谱“ 和 “离谱“ 之间反复横跳?
它通过疯狂看人类的文字(书、网页、聊天记录),学会了「人类说话的概率」,然后就能跟你聊天、写文章、编故事,甚至装成莎士比亚。当 AI 回答你关于古埃及金字塔的问题时,它并不是真正理解了考古学和历史,而是巧妙地重组了互联网上关于这个话题的无数文字。在 AI 时代,真正的智慧不在于拥有 AI 这个工具,而在于明智地使用它,同时保持批判性思考的能力。接下来,我们就扒开 AI 的「语言魔术」,看看它到底是怎么「一本正经说胡话」的。它的所有「知识」,只是从海量文字中统计出的「词语搭配套路」。
2025-03-24 14:02:21
742
原创 【实战分享】10大支付平台全方面分析,独立开发必备!
从0到1的探索为产品接入支付之路心得,10大支付平台全方位对比,轻松为个人独立产品搞定收款难题
2025-03-07 11:31:15
817
原创 【完整汇总】近 5 年 JavaScript 新特性完整总览
关于 JavaScript 近 5 年新特性完整总结,一篇文章带你全面掌握ES2019-ES2024所有实用功能
2025-03-04 15:12:48
754
原创 我悟了!原来本地图片预览还能这样搞
在网页开发中,经常会遇到需要让用户上传图片并在上传前进行预览的需求。这样做的好处显而易见:用户可以立即看到自己选择的图片是否正确,避免了不必要的上传和服务器资源浪费,提升了用户体验。
2025-02-19 16:30:07
243
原创 《Indie Tools • 半月刊》第001期
《INDIE TOOLS》专注于分享独立开发出海精选、最新、最实用的工具。 欢迎订阅半月刊:《INDIE TOOLS • 半月刊》 如果本文能给你提供启发和帮助,感谢各位小伙
2025-02-17 11:06:06
717
原创 找到你的小众市场,打造你的专属产品几个步骤
想做个人产品却不知从何下手?本文为你提供7步实用指南,从兴趣出发,教你如何找准小众市场,打造属于自己的特色产品。
2025-02-12 17:14:34
298
原创 独立开发的灵感哪儿来?
最近看了不少关于创意的文章,感觉思路清晰了不少。与其藏着掖着,不如把我的笔记整理出来,跟大家分享分享,希望能对你有所启发。总而言之,创意不是什么高不可攀的东西,它就隐藏在我们的生活之中,在我们的问题之中。从自己的“不方便”出发,寻找痛点。从自己的“兴趣”出发,保持热情。多观察生活,多记录思考。敢于尝试,不断迭代。相信自己,坚持下去!记住,灵感不是等来的,而是自己找来的。别再苦思冥想了,回头看看你的生活,看看你遇到的问题,答案可能就在那里等着你呢!加油!
2025-02-05 10:51:12
339
原创 2025 开局,我的身体给我上了一课
2025年,我被身体狠狠地上了一课!最终不得不放弃?这不仅是一个关于放弃的故事,更是一个关于接受和改变的过程
2025-01-19 16:50:11
319
原创 消失的一个多月,我用 AI 做了三个项目,简直不要太爽!
AI 工具确实能帮我们提高效率,解决问题。但千万别盲目依赖它,你让 AI 帮你实现什么,也要搞清楚它实现的步骤和原理。还有一点很重要:用 AI 完成的项目,你一定要熟悉!要不然,一旦出现 bug,你连文件在哪都不知道,更别说修复了!(这一点,也是我使用 AI 的心得体验吧,也看到了很多人这样的经历)好了,一次水的文章就先聊到这儿吧。也欢迎大家留言和交流!
2024-12-31 16:34:57
1097
原创 图片渐进式加载优化实践指南
常规的图片优化有压缩图片、使用 CSS sprites、懒加载、预加载、CDN 缓存、合适的图片格式、七牛 CDN 图片参数等等,这里不在赘述,这篇文章我们将讨论其他几种方案~
2024-11-21 15:10:14
665
原创 NPM 包开发与优化全面指南
Hey, 我是Immerse系列文章首发于【Immerse】,更多内容请关注该网站转载说明:转载请注明原文出处及版权声明!UMD 是一种允许模块在多种环境(CommonJS、AMD、全局变量)中工作的模式。// AMD} else {// 浏览器全局变量});
2024-10-28 10:47:33
1233
原创 VS Code 代码片段指南: 从基础到高级技巧
系列首发于公众号『非同质前端札记』,若不想错过更多精彩内容,请“星标”一下,敬请关注公众号最新消息。今天咱们来聊聊 VS Code 里的自定义代码片段。这玩意儿简直是提升编码效率的神器, 用好了能让你敲代码更方便!不管你是刚入行的菜鸟还是身经百战的老兵,这篇攻略都能让你在代码片段的世界里玩得飞起。系好安全带,我们开始起飞啦!记住, 代码片段的强大之处在于它能让你的编码更快、更准、更一致。但是,就像所有的工具一样,关键在于怎么用。别怕尝试和实验,找到最适合你的方式。
2024-08-30 15:33:05
1418
原创 别再被坑了! JavaScript类型检测的最佳实践
如果需要全面准确的类型识别,是最佳选择。如果只需要简单区分基本类型,typeof就足够了。如果要检查对象是否属于特定类型,可以用instanceof。在实际应用中,我们可以根据具体需求选择合适的方法。上次我开发了一个工具,可以批量清理无用的仓库。如果你感兴趣,可以去看看哦!😊介绍文章GitHub 仓库地址如果你觉得这个工具对你有所帮助,请不要忘记给我的 GitHub 仓库点个 Star⭐!你的支持是我前进的动力!
2024-08-16 15:43:44
455
原创 Next.js 中为什么 App Router 可能是未来,但 Pages Router 仍然重要?
Next.js 作为一个强大的 React 框架,为开发者提供了两种路由系统:App Router 和 Pages Router。这两种路由系统各有特色,适用于不同的场景。本文将深入探讨这两种路由系统的区别、优缺点和使用场景,帮助你做出最佳选择。App Router 是 Next.js 13 引入的新路由系统,它使用 目录来组织路由,带来了许多令人兴奋的新特性。React 服务器组件支持:这是一个游戏规则改变者,允许在服务器端渲染复杂组件,大大提升了性能。灵活的布局系统:通过嵌套布局,你可以更容易地创建复
2024-08-01 21:15:00
1673
原创 你还在手动操作仓库?这款 CLI 工具让你效率飙升300%!
作为一名开发者,我经常会在 GitHub 和 Gitee 上 fork 各种项目。时间一长,这些仓库就会堆积如山,变成了“垃圾仓库”。每次打开代码托管平台,看到那些不再需要的仓库,我的强迫症就会发作。手动一个一个删除这些仓库不仅耗时耗力,还非常枯燥乏味。为了彻底解决这个问题,不如解放双手,开发一个工具,能够快速、批量地删除这些不再需要的仓库。于是,一个全新的开源工具del-repos诞生了!del-repos—— 这个工具旨在帮助开发者更加轻松地管理他们的代码仓库,尤其是批量删除不再需要的仓库。
2024-06-24 17:52:32
292
原创 组长:你熟悉过React,开发个Next项目模板吧,我:怎么扯上关系的?
这个项目模板是为初学者快速了解 Next.js 企业项目模板大体框架。通过这个模板,可以快速搭建一个标准化的企业项目,减少重复劳动,提高开发效率。模板中集成了多种现代化的开发工具和框架,确保项目的可维护性和扩展性。总的来说,这个 Next.js 企业项目模板是一个非常有价值的工具,特别适合初学者和企业开发者使用。它不仅提供了一个标准化的项目结构,还集成了多种现代化的开发工具和框架,确保项目的高效开发和维护。希望这个模板能帮助你更快地上手 Next.js 开发,并构建出高质量的企业应用。
2024-06-12 13:44:09
796
原创 JavaScript 事件循环竟还能这样玩!
事件循环是 JavaScript 运行时环境中处理异步操作的核心机制。它允许 JavaScript 在执行任务时不会阻塞主线程,从而实现非阻塞 I/O 操作。调用栈(Call Stack)调用栈是一个 LIFO(后进先出)结构,用于存储当前执行的函数调用。当一个函数被调用时,它会被推入调用栈,当函数执行完毕后,它会从调用栈中弹出。任务队列(Task Queue)任务队列存储了所有等待执行的任务,这些任务通常是异步操作的回调函数,例如setTimeout、I/O 操作等。
2024-06-03 10:29:00
740
原创 爆爽,英语小白怒刷 50 课!像玩游戏一样学习英语~
因为工作需要,且一手的资料都是英文,所以不得不重拾起它,但可能会有人说有翻译插件呀,确实,但我在我个人看来去学习一手资料能获取的信息点、了解的更多。所以,不如重拾起它,之前广泛(时态,语法,音标,单词…)的英语学习,对于我来说很难坚持下去,所以,这次就聚焦于一个方向:程序员英语,学习内容以前端开发中常用到的专业术语,名词,及各种交流表达为主。因此后期会隔 2 周时间更新一下最近的英语学习内容。
2024-05-10 17:47:10
786
原创 爆爽,英语小白怒刷50课!像玩游戏一样学习英语~
重点!!!(先看这)1.清楚自己学英语的目的, 先搞清楚目标,再行动2.自身现在最需要的东西:词汇量?口语?还是阅读能力?3.找对应的书籍,学习资料4.往兴趣靠拢:网上有大量的推荐美剧学习、小说学习,不要被他们迷了眼,适合他们的不一定适合你,找到适合的你才能长期坚持下去。•我的学习方式:比如我要学习和了解第一手的信息,而信息的呈现方式又是英语, 所以我的目标是:程序员英语 一个超好用英语学...
2024-05-10 17:17:50
440
原创 一定要避坑:关于微信H5分享,温馨提示你不要再踩坑了!!!
注意事项:在使用 JSDK 之前,确保先进行初始化成功后再进行分享配置。在定制分享配置时,避免使用 window.location.origin 生成链接,而是使用下述提到的方法来生成,(盲猜,可能是 IOS 和 Android 兼容性问题)link: `${${${${this需要注意的是,H5 分享与网页的 hash 或 history 模式无关。解决方案✅从公众号菜单中的链接打开或从气泡链接进入,同样可以生效。✅✅。
2024-04-03 15:40:36
1800
原创 JavaScript中的包装类型详解
包装类型是 JavaScript 中的一种特殊对象,它们将基本类型的值“包装”在对象中,使我们能够在基本类型上调用方法。StringNumber和Boolean。例如,当我们在一个字符串上调用方法时,JavaScript 会临时将其转换(或者说“包装”)为一个对象,这样就可以调用方法了。// 输出 "HELLO"在这个例子中,str是一个字符串基本类型,但我们可以在它上面调用方法。这是因为 JavaScript 在后台临时将str包装成了一个String对象,然后在这个对象上调用了方法。
2024-02-26 14:26:02
410
原创 一个菜鸡前端的3年总结-「2023」
一眨眼出来工作已经三年了这三年自己在各方面都有所提升,做了许多事情…,今年也正好做个总结吧自己想到那写到哪,有点乱,见谅!这三年,不断在提升自己,时刻要求自己不要浪费时间,因为刚开始的前几年是最重要的,在个人成长提升上自己要做到坚决服从自己的目标管理,时时刻刻记住自己的那几句话。最后,如果有喜欢跑步、喜欢阅读,喜欢探索技术的小伙伴可以一起监督打卡呀,一个人做这些有时候确实缺少一些动力,很难坚持下去,但如果有共同目标的小伙伴一起,我相信可以坚持的更久,更能很好的做自己。
2024-01-30 14:26:03
829
转载 一步到位,免费领取2024微信红包!!!
感谢大家一直以来的陪伴与支持!在这新年来临之际为大家精心准备了独一无二的微信红包封面让祝福更独特,更富特色!数量有限,先到先得~领取后也可以分享给朋友免费领取哦红包最后,我们衷心愿望:在2024这祥龙纵横的一年,祝大家鸿运当头,新年开门红!希望你我他她它,每天开心笑哈哈。...
2024-01-27 11:26:05
89
原创 终极秘诀:打破无代码状态的小方法
1. 重构的记录格式?每个重构手法都有 5 个部分名称(name):建构一个重构词汇名称的对应表速写(sketch):帮助我们更快的找到所需要的手法动机(motivation):会介绍 “为什么需要做这个重构”和 “什么情况下不该做这个重构”做法(mechanics):如何一步一步进行重构范例(examples):以一个简单的例子来说明此重构手法如何运作牢记重构的一点:小步前进,情况越复杂,步子就要越小。
2023-11-04 18:06:57
237
原创 不愧是疑问解决神器(二)!你强任你强
1. 重构的记录格式?每个重构手法都有 5 个部分名称(name):建构一个重构词汇名称的对应表速写(sketch):帮助我们更快的找到所需要的手法动机(motivation):会介绍 “为什么需要做这个重构”和 “什么情况下不该做这个重构”做法(mechanics):如何一步一步进行重构范例(examples):以一个简单的例子来说明此重构手法如何运作牢记重构的一点:小步前进,情况越复杂,步子就要越小。
2023-11-04 18:02:17
189
原创 不愧是疑问解决神器(二)!你强任你强
1. 重构的记录格式?每个重构手法都有 5 个部分名称(name):建构一个重构词汇名称的对应表速写(sketch):帮助我们更快的找到所需要的手法动机(motivation):会介绍 “为什么需要做这个重构”和 “什么情况下不该做这个重构”做法(mechanics):如何一步一步进行重构范例(examples):以一个简单的例子来说明此重构手法如何运作牢记重构的一点:小步前进,情况越复杂,步子就要越小。
2023-10-22 16:27:52
146
原创 不愧是疑问解决神器!你强任你强
1. 这本书讲了什么?解释了重构的原理和最佳实践,并指出何时何 地你应该开始挖掘你的代码以求改善。2. 这本书的核心是什么?本书的核心是一系列完整的重构方法,其 中每一项都介绍一种经过实践检验的代码变换手法的动机和技术3. 重构的关键是什么?理解,有条不絮的理解是进行重构的关键。运用本书的重构手法,保证每次只走一步。4. 什么是重构?在不改变代码外在行为的前提下,对代码做出修改,以此来改进程序的内部结构。重构就是在代码写好之后改进它的设计。5. 这本书的核心部分?
2023-10-01 15:11:31
141
原创 不愧是疑问解决神器!你强任你强~
前言系列首发于公众号『前端进阶圈』,若不想错过更多精彩内容,请“星标”一下,敬请关注公众号最新消息。•在过去,我习惯用这种方式来阅读书籍或文章:先快速浏览一遍,然后再进行复读,并最终总结所学的知识点。然而,长期以来,我发现这种方式并不能满足我最初阅读的目的。我相信许多人也有相似的经历,我们阅读某些文章或书籍,要么是为了扩展知识面,要么是为了解决某个问题,或者是对某个话题产生兴趣。然而,事实上,我...
2023-10-01 14:49:11
32
空空如也
(标签-微信小程序)
2024-03-14
TA创建的收藏夹 TA关注的收藏夹
TA关注的人